What is the specialty of Bapu Tower
Speaking to Local 18, Bapu Tower Director Vinay Kumar said that Bapu Tower is a museum dedicated to the Father of the Nation Mahatma Gandhi. Different phase of Bapu’s life is depicted through different multimedia. Saying multimedia means that it has been produced using films, slides, paintings, photos, videos and other mediums. It is a unique museum in the country. This is nowhere in the whole country. When the audience arrives here, he will get to know about the life of Mahatma Gandhi and can also feel his values.
Viewers will be able to watch the film on 360 degree display
Director Vinay Kumar said that a specialty of Bapu Tower is its outer copper layer, which weighs about 40 tons. Its height is about 101 feet. The construction of galleries is friendly for the audience. As soon as you enter the building, there is a 360 degree orientation hall where many interesting stories are presented. Viewers will be able to consider Mahatma Gandhi’s life journey digitally.
What is timing and ticket rate
Viewers above 12 years will have to take a ticket of 50 rupees to roam in Bapu Tower. A ticket rate of Rs 10 is fixed for children from 5 to 12 years. At the same time, there will be a provision of free entry for disabled persons and elderly above 70 years. In this museum, free arrangements have also been made for persons coming to visit the students of government and private schools, groups of more than 25 of institutions and offices. The booking counter will be open from Tuesday to Sunday from 10:30 am to 4 pm. The museum for the audience will be completely closed on Monday. There is a system of booking tickets in five slots per day. Director Vinay Kumar said that the audience will take at least two hours to visit the museum.
